Abstract (EN)

Image processing can be expressed as the method used to obtain the specific images by detecting an image in digital environment and revealing the meaningful and useful information within it. Part of a video or a photograph can be an input for image processing. The desired outputs are obtained by unwanted image or noise blocking by various operations on these inputs. Some of the examples used today are; reading of human writes by computers, photo filtering tools used in social media and various platforms, plate identification systems in traffic, face recognition systems. Exam assessments in classrooms, schools and various examination centers are also one of the most common examples of the subject. In this thesis, we aimed to build a test form evaluation application that can read various test forms captured in different environments, under different light conditions, from different angles as input, using image filtering and image warping techniques on image and returns answers as results.
